The Cleveland Browns are known for having one of the most loyal fanbases in all of pro sports, but Sundays at FirstEngery Stadium have become a form of torture for the passionate fans.

This year's 2-10 squad is arguably the worst since the franchise was re-launched in 1999, after moving to Baltimore in '95. Things have gotten so bad at the bitterly dubbed "Factory of Sadness" that fans are attending games with the sole purpose of calling out the current regime.

Sadly, Cleveland's sports misery isn't limited to football. Their fans have suffered through decades of heartbreak from all of their pro teams.

But now, those fans can pay their respects to infamous moments like "The Drive," "The Fumble" and "The Shot" in a lighthearted, fun way -- with Cleveland Drinks: The Ohio Party Game.

ADVERTISEMENT

The game, which is full of sports references and Cleveland pop culture, is described as a fun, fast-paced card game that is easy to play. Players take turns picking up cards from the pile and follow whatever Cleveland-specific drinking instruction it might command.

The sports-related cards will surely bring back some unsettling memories, but the jokes are spot-on.

While the game takes jabs at the Cleveland sports teams, the creators are suffering fans themselves, and say it's all in good fun.
